Hill Rom Holdings is traded for 0.00. About 84.0% of the company shares are owned by institutional investors. The company last dividend was issued on the 14th of December 2021. Hill Rom Holdings had 10000:5366 split on the 1st of April 2008.

Other Consideration for investing in Hill Stock

If you are still planning to invest in Hill Rom Holdings check if it may still be traded through OTC markets such as Pink Sheets or OTC Bulletin Board. You may also purchase it directly from the company, but this is not always possible and may require contacting the company directly. Please note that delisted stocks are often considered to be more risky investments, as they are no longer subject to the same regulatory and reporting requirements as listed stocks. Therefore, it is essential to carefully research the Hill Rom's history and understand the potential risks before investing.
